Waterfall service involves the installation, repair, and maintenance of waterfall features typically integrated into residential landscapes or commercial properties. This service includes creating natural-looking waterfalls, ensuring proper water flow, and installing necessary pumps and filtration systems. Skilled contractors focus on designing features that enhance the aesthetic appeal of outdoor spaces while maintaining functionality and safety. Homeowners considering a waterfall feature often seek professionals to help bring their vision to life or to repair existing installations that have become damaged or less effective over time.

This service helps solve common problems such as water leaks, uneven water flow, or pump failures that can lead to water damage or safety hazards. Over time, waterfalls may develop issues like clogged filters, broken pumps, or structural wear, which can diminish their visual appeal and functionality. Local service providers can assess these problems, recommend appropriate solutions, and perform repairs to restore the feature's proper operation. Regular maintenance can also prevent many issues, ensuring that the waterfall remains a beautiful and safe addition to the property.

The overview below groups typical Waterfall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or waterfall service jobs like fixing leaks or small blockages gener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ine repairs fall within this middle range, making them the most common projects for local contractors.

Mid-Size Projects - Larger tasks such as replacing sections of a waterfall system or addressing moderate damage can cost between $600 and $2,000. These projects are less frequent but represent a significant portion of service requests.

Full System Replacement - Complete waterfall system overhauls or replacements usually start around $2,500 and can go beyond $5,000 for more extensive or complex jobs. Many projects in this tier are larger and more involved, requiring detailed planning and labor.

Custom or Complex Installations - Highly customized or intricate waterfall services, including design and installation of elaborate features, can exceed $5,000. Such projects are less common and typically involve specialized work by local contractors.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
